I signed up for a years service on 8-15-19. I had an automatic monthly credit card deduction for the years service set up. Fast forward to 07-26-20 I called to request a service call which are supposed to be free during my contract period if I have an issue. I explained there was a recurring issue with the original pest I initially called them for a year earlier. They then informed me (after promising to come out and look at my issue 2 times before) that I would have to pay again as I cancelled my service. Yes I did cancel my service but payments continued as I was on a 1 year contract and I knew this. But if you don't cancel in advance you are automatically charged for the next quarter. My issue is that I paid for an entire year of service and that service doesn't end until 8-14-20 irregardless if I cancelled. I've not had any issues until the end of last month and when I called I got nothing but a runaround from what amounts to a bunch of incompetent people who don't want to stand by their service. If their service is so great then why am I getting critters and then a bunch of nonsense when I call them and ask for a service call? I paid for a year and expect a years worth of service. I've never had to call for a service visit and don't understand the difference of calling in the 2nd quarter of contract vs the 4th quarter of contract. I'm still within the period for which I paid. I've spoke with a couple neighbors who use Turner as well and they too will be canceling at the end of their terms. These people don't stand by their service or contract. Will not recommend much less use their service again.
